October 25, 2000

Kumar Chellapilla Gives Keynote Lecture at Learning'00

Madrid, Spain - Kumar Chellapilla, senior staff scientist of Natural Selection, Inc.Ò, opened the Learning'00 conference in Madrid, Spain with his keynote lecture, titled "Evolving an expert checkers player without using human expertise." Chellapilla's talk featured the groundbreaking research in coevolutionary learning in the game of checkers, performed in collaboration with Dr. David Fogel, executive vice president and chief scientist. "This was an important venue to discuss our research," said Chellapilla. He continued, "this meeting brought together a wide range of people interested in all forms of learning." Evolutionary computation is going to play an increasing role in machine learning, and it's important to identify the similarities between evolutionary learning and other forms of learning."

Natural Selection, Inc.Ò was founded in 1993 to address complex problems in industry, medicine, and defense. The company possesses unique expertise in computational intelligence techniques, including evolutionary computation, neural networks, and fuzzy logic. The corporation's research efforts support the discovery of new pharmaceuticals, the automated detection and diagnosis of breast cancer from film-screen mammograms, optical character recognition, and a variety of military and industrial projects.
